Navigating the Dashboard
- Dashboard Overview
- Upon logging into your SlideFill account, you'll be greeted by the dashboard. This overview page displays your recent projects, quick access to create a new presentation, and insights into your usage statistics.
- Projects Section
- Accessing Your Projects: Click on the "Projects" tab to view a list of your ongoing and completed presentations. Here, you can edit, duplicate, or delete existing projects.
- Organizing Projects: Use the sorting and filtering options to organize your projects by date, name, or status, making it easier to find what you're looking for.
- Templates Library
- Finding Templates: Navigate to the "Templates" section to browse through SlideFill's extensive library of customizable templates. You can filter templates by category, purpose, or popularity.
- Custom Templates: Learn how to upload and manage your custom templates. This section provides guidelines on creating templates in Google Slides and integrating them with SlideFill placeholders.
- Data Sources
- Connecting Data: The "Data Sources" tab is where you connect your Google Sheets to SlideFill. Follow the prompts to authorize SlideFill to access your Google account and select the specific Sheets you want to use.
- Managing Data Connections: View and manage your connected data sources. You can add new connections or remove existing ones to keep your data sources up-to-date.
- Settings and Account Management
- Profile Settings: Click on your profile icon to access account settings. Here, you can update your personal information, change your password, and configure your preferences.
- Subscription Details: In the "Subscription" section, review your current plan, see your usage, and explore upgrade options to unlock additional features.
- Support and Resources
- Getting Help: If you need assistance, the "Support" tab offers access to SlideFill's help center, FAQs, and contact information for customer support.
- Learning Resources: Discover tutorials, guides, and tips to enhance your SlideFill experience. This section is regularly updated with new content to help you make the most of the platform.
